Track patch worn by Bob Wobbrock at Gardena High School, Los Angeles, California

- Robert Wobbrock attended Gardena High School in California from 1953 to 1956. A typical kid of the fifties, he lettered in football and track. He received this letter during his junior year hence the one winged foot representing track and the two stars embroidered on the letter. For each year someone lettered in a varsity sport they would receive a letter with the year indicated in the amount of “athletic symbols or stars” embroidered on the letter. This practiced changed sometime during the 1970s and the athlete was given one letter throughout their high school career and given a gold bar for each subsequent year.
